"""Evaluate a trained agent on MiniWoB++ tasks."""
import json
import argparse
import re
from agent_system.environments.env_package.miniwob.miniwob_env import MiniWoBEnv
from agent_system.environments.prompts.miniwob import SYSTEM_PROMPT, build_messages
EVAL_TASKS = [
"miniwob/click-button-v1",
"miniwob/click-dialog-v1",
"miniwob/click-link-v1",
"miniwob/click-checkboxes-v1",
"miniwob/enter-text-v1",
"miniwob/enter-password-v1",
"miniwob/login-user-v1",
"miniwob/navigate-tree-v1",
"miniwob/search-engine-v1",
"miniwob/social-media-v1",
]
NUM_EPISODES_PER_TASK = 50
def parse_action_from_response(response: str) -> str:
"""从模型 response 中提取 <action>...</action> 标签内的动作。"""
m = re.search(r'<action>(.*?)</action>', response, re.DOTALL)
if m:
return m.group(1).strip()
# fallback: 尝试直接匹配 click/type/press 模式
m = re.search(r'(click|type|press)\(.*?\)', response)
if m:
return m.group(0)
# 无法解析时返回 noop
return "click(0, 0)"
def evaluate(model, task_name: str, num_episodes: int = 50) -> float:
"""在单个任务上评估 num_episodes 个 episode,返回 success rate。"""
env = MiniWoBEnv(task_name=task_name, max_steps=10)
successes = 0
for ep in range(num_episodes):
obs = env.reset()
done = False
history = []
step = 0
while not done:
messages = build_messages(obs, history, step)
response = model.predict(messages)
action_str = parse_action_from_response(response)
prev_obs = obs
obs, reward, done, info = env.step(action_str)
history.append({"action": action_str, "obs": prev_obs})
step += 1
if env.total_reward > 0:
successes += 1
env.close()
return successes / num_episodes
